Nigeria: Recruitment - Immigration Warns Public Against Fraudsters

The Nigeria Immigration Service (NIS) has warned members of the public to beware of activities fraudsters.
This is contained in a statement issued by the NIS spokesperson, Mr Ekpedeme King, on Saturday in Abuja.
King said that the Service was not engaged in any recruitment exercise.
He cautioned members of the public, especially the youths, not to pay money to any faceless individual in a bid to get employment into the service.
" The attention of the Comptroller-General of Nigeria Immigration Service, Mr Martins Abeshi, has been drawn to some faceless individuals deceiving unsuspecting members of the public for placement into the Nigeria Immigration Service.
" It has therefore, become imperative to state categorically that the Nigeria Immigration Service is not engaged in any recruitment exercise," he said.
He called on Nigerians to ignore any offer of employment as such activity remained the handiwork of fraudsters.
King explained that the service had a duty to advertise any recruitment in line with the extant laws and would always advertise it in the media
